When I was 11 years old I got my first walk-man which played audio cassettes (and sometimes ate them). That was in 1981. In 1989 when I was 19 years old I bought my first CD player walk-man. It was big and bulkier than the cassette version but it was pretty darn cool and I was paranoid to let anyone see it for fear of it being snatched.

In the late 90′s I remember seeing the first mp3 player, I think it was the Rio(?).  It only stored a few cd’s which to me is bogus for the price but whatever. Then the iPod came out and that was pretty darn cool.

In 2005 I got the Dell DJ but I wish that I had gotten an iPod instead.

What a long way we have come that we now have an mp3 player that not only plays music but also video games, records HD video, views websites and now has a new thing called FaceTime which allows you to have a live video streaming phone call with someone. And it’s not even an iPhone either, it’s an iPod, a music player. The walk-man of the 21st century if you will.

Amazing!  What will they come up with next?

My First Nook Book Completed – Dead Until Dark by Charlaine Harris

dead until dark nook 200x300 My First Nook Book Completed   Dead Until Dark by Charlaine HarrisWell I finally did it. I finished reading my very first Nook book which was Dead Until Dark by Charlaine Harris. It’s the first Sookie Stackhouse novel that True Blood is based upon.

The first e-book I ever read was on my computer last month but this is the first e-book that I’ve read on my new Nook. It was certainly an interesting experience.

It took me 4 days which is the usual for me if I read 2 or more chapters per day. The first day I read 2 chapters, the 2nd day 2 chapters, yesterday 2 chapters then today, the 4th day I read the final 5 chapters.

I did get many chances to look up the definitions of many words which thrilled me to no end because I just can’t stand reading a book and not knowing what the meaning of a certain word is. I start feeling stupid because I don’t understand. I dismiss it without even trying to find out then I’m lost.

What’s even funnier is that while I was reading this entire book, I was reading it with a southern accent in my head with the characters voices/accents. And each character had a different accent so I had to keep switching voices and accents. Sometimes I had to cheat and look at who was talking before reading the paragraph so I could make sure that I wasn’t using Sookies voice for Arlene or Eric’s voice for Bill etc. But it didn’t end there because when I would talk to people either on the phone or even talking to Chip or the dog I would still have a little trace of that southern accent.

What was cool about this book was that while I was reading it I already knew what was going to happen before it happened because I’ve seen the show and I remembered it. Unfortunately, some of the things changed.

SPOILER ALERT!!!

Like for example, Tara Thornton and her mother were not in the book, Miss Jeanette wasn’t in there and she didn’t die at the end in Andy’s car and Bill never turned Jessica and he never went on trial, instead he got some kind of vampire promotion in the vampire world that he lives in. Also, there was another vampire named Bubba who was never in the show and he was there when Sookie was getting beat up by Rene who didn’t even die at the end of the book.

My friend Alyce told me that this book was not like the shows and I thought that she was saying that it wasn’t like the shows meaning it had nothing to do with Bon Temps and Bill and Sookie etc. But what she meant was that it read for Sookies point of view the entire time and so you never read anything that happened to anyone in this book that was not around Sookie.

In other words, you are reading from her viewpoint and no one else. Since she can’t see what’s happening to other people, neither can we (as the reader).

I definitely enjoyed it even though it was very different from the show in that respect. I feel like I got a taste of an alternate True Blood. Which by the way, they never mentioned the words “True Blood”. They always said “synthetic blood” and Bill apparently hated it, he preferred to drink Sookie instead.

I loved this book and can’t wait for the next one. I plan on buying each book once every month until June and by then I will be on the 10th book. I don’t want to read all of the books at once, I have many other books that I want to read of different stories so I have to give those books a chance too.

My Nook Battery

werenook 200x300 My Nook BatteryBefore I go on a rant, I would just like to say that I love my Nook. I’ve had nothing but fun with it since I got it on Friday night. Yes, I have had some irritations but the more I play with it the more I understand it and love it.

With that said, I just want to say how I am questioning their “10-day battery life” statement. I’ve only had it since Friday night which is when I first charged it. The next day the battery had started going down so I plugged it in again so I am really counting from that moment which would be Saturday afternoon when it was at full capacity which for some odd reason was only 97% when the light went off and it stopped charging.

So that would be 3 days that I have been playing with it when it went from 97% battery life down to 24%. It’s supposed to be 10 days, not 3.

Note that they said 10 days IF the wi-fi is turned off. The Kindle wi-fi has a 30 day battery with wi-fi turned off and it only uses the battery when you turn the page right? So I think that this is 10 days because every time you have to look up a word it turns the LCD screen on which uses battery so that’s why instead of 30 days it’s only 10 days.

How much time do they estimate per day that you should use the Nook to give you 10 days of battery power? 1 hour per day? 2 hours?

Maybe I’m using it more than they would have estimated that a person would use it and that’s why it’s sucking so much energy from the battery.

I think what’s happening is that every time I don’t understand a word I look it up which turns the LCD on. And before I start reading I usually go into the daily to see what they have in there. I pick up my Nook several times per day and look at stuff in the Nook store. So maybe I am over using it.

I mean it doesn’t really bother me that much that it’s only been 3 days and I’ve already used 75% of the battery because I can certainly plug it in every few days. It’s the principle that they say “10 days” without a charge that gets me because I’m seriously wondering just how long they expect a person would be using this thing.

Look, I’m a reader, I love to read… a lot. I’m gonna be using this thing for hours at a time, maybe 4-6 hours per day. It’s gonna get its use whether I’m reading a book, magazine or newspaper or just browsing the Nook store. So I guess if I over use it like that I’m gonna have to expect to charge it every few days.

I guess I’ll just have to deal with it lol.

Shocking Gates Drama

gates Shocking Gates Drama

I love this new show The Gates on ABC. It’s about a rich community that all live in the safety of “The Gates” with round the clock security. They have their own schools, their own shops, their own police station. Nobody gets into the gates unless they live there.

What’s different is that there are supernatural beings living within the gates. Vampires, Werewolves and even a Succubus.

In last nights episode, the main vampire couple Dylan and his wife Claire deal with the kidnapping of their daughter Emily. But we find out in the episode how they adopted her. Claire it turns out killed her parents but then discovered after the fact that they had a baby sleeping upstairs.

Instead of leaving the baby in the house until the parents are discovered so that she can grow up with her next of kin, they take her. They justify it by saying that they thought that the parents (who were both on drugs at the time that she killed them) were scum and nobody would care about them.

Nick the vampire who kidnapped Emily, brought her to the same house she was taken from to stay with her aunt and uncle who have been searching for her for the last 8 years and it turns out her birth name is Piper.

The moral question is, when Claire and Dylan finally figured it all out and went to the house to get her back, should they have taken her away from her true family? I mean sure, when they kidnapped her they legally adopted her, probably from vampires no doubt but should that adoption have continued? Shouldn’t they have done the right thing and say “look, we know what we did was wrong and we know that she should spend the rest of her childhood with her true family”?

With all these child abductions and child murders in the news lately, I think that the answer is they should have surrendered her to her legal family. The reality of it is, the only way they are going to continue living as docile vampires is if they keep Emily. If they lost her they would go back to their old ways of killing people. And even though it’s wrong for them to keep Emily, they need Emily more than she needs them.

I can’t condone their actions but it is however just a tv show. In real life they would’ve been expected to give her up, as they should have in the show.
